Workers' Compensation

Workers who have been injured and sickened by asbestos exposure may be eligible to claim workers compensation benefits. Benefits from workers' compensation can include medical costs, partial wages, and other expenses that are incurred due to workplace injuries. Workers compensation claims aren't the most suitable option for asbestos-exposed individuals because they offer the lowest maximum benefit and have a limited time for filing.

An experienced attorney can help determine whether an asbestos-related illness is a work-related injury, and determine if an individual is eligible for workers' comp. An attorney can also provide information on the specific laws of each state regarding workers' compensation and assist with completing the deadlines for filing claims that vary from state to state. An attorney can provide advice on other legal options for obtaining compensation, for instance, filing an asbestos lawsuit or a mesothelioma fund claim.

A lawyer can also determine the most likely sources of liability for an individual's asbestos-related illness. Asbestos, a fibrous material can lead to serious health issues, such as asbestosis or mesothelioma. An attorney can investigate the background of the client's employer and identify potential asbestos-exposure sites. Construction and demolition companies, power plants and schools are the most likely employers for someone with asbestos-related conditions.

Asbestos fibers may become airborne, and employees and visitors to a construction site can inhale them. The microscopic fibres that it contains can accumulate in the lungs and other organs causing inflammation and scarring which leads to cancers, tumors, and other illnesses. Asbestos victims may not realize that their ailments are linked to their exposure until years after the fact.

Personal Injury

Asbestos lawyers help victims who have been exposed to asbestos and are now suffering from an illness or illness like mesothelioma. The condition can develop 15 to 60 years after exposure, and may even be fatal. In addition to bringing a suit against the company responsible for exposure, asbestos victims could qualify to receive financial compensation from asbestos victim trust funds.

Asbestos is a group of naturally occurring minerals that are made of a thin, tough fiber. The resistance of the mineral to fire, heat and chemicals made it a sought-after material for industrial manufactures during the 20th century. Unfortunately, many manufacturing companies were unable to recognize or adequately kept asbestos' dangers from the public and caused the deaths of thousands of Americans.

Victims who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ness, such as mesothelioma or lung cancer, can make a personal injury claim against the companies who manufactured and distributed or installed the deadly substance. The lawsuits seek to recover compensation for the victims' medical bills, lost wages and suffering and pain.

New York law generally gives plaintiffs three years from date of diagnosis to file an action for personal injury. However the statute of limitations is often tolled in asbestos cases as symptoms typically do not appear for 30 to 50 years following the initial exposure.

Wrongful Death

If someone dies by exposure to asbestos the family can bring a lawsuit for the victim's wrongful death. This type of lawsuit is filed by the decedent's estate, and is possible to file it regardless of whether or no decedent had an estate plan. A lawyer who has been convicted of wrongful death can help family members receive compensation from those who are responsible.

These claims are brought against employers and property owners who neglected to keep workers safe from asbestos. In these cases, the main problem is that asbestos particles inhaled cause fibrosis in the lung's lining. Over time the fibrosis can turn malignant and may turn into tumors, such as mesothelioma. Asbestos wrongful-death attorneys must prove that the defendant's wrongful conduct caused the asbestos-related illness. They must also prove that the mesothelioma is the direct result of exposure to asbestos. This requires accessing medical records, interviewing witnesses, and obtaining documents from the workplaces where the deceased was employed.
